VŠPJ has launched the preparatory phase of the HR Excellence in Research process

VŠPJ is working on documentation aimed at securing the HR Excellence in Research award

From 2026, the Jihlava Polytechnic University plans to participate in the process leading to the award of the internationally recognised HR Excellence in Research award. This is not merely a formal label or symbolic award, but a long-term and systematic framework that helps higher education institutions to systematically develop the conditions for high-quality research and creative activity. It focuses on key areas such as transparent and fair recruitment, ethics and research integrity, professional development and the creation of a supportive working environment.

What is HR Excellence in Research (HR Award)

The HR Excellence in Research award is presented by the European Commission to organisations that demonstrably implement the principles of the European Charter for Researchers into their day-to-day practice and continuously assess their implementation. This is not a one-off exercise, but a process based on regular assessment, continuous improvement and renewal in successive cycles. In this way, the organisation demonstrates not only its commitment to internationally recognised standards, but also its ability to effectively incorporate these standards into the institution’s operations.

What is the procedure at VŠPJ

During 2026, VŠPJ intends to formally confirm its commitment to the principles of the European Charter for Researchers. Subsequently, in the coming months, the key supporting documents required for the process will be prepared. Following approval of the so-called endorsement letter, a twelve-month deadline applies, in accordance with European Commission rules, for the submission of the mandatory documentation, in particular:
  • GAP analyses – that is, an assessment of the current situation and the identification of areas for further development,
  • OTM-R checklist – an overview focusing on open, transparent and high-quality procedures for recruiting research staff,
  • Action Plan – a set of specific measures, responsibilities and deadlines that will lead to improvements in current practice.

What this process will bring to staff and the school

Participation in the HR Excellence in Research process will bring benefits to both staff and the institution as a whole. These include, in particular:
  • clearer and more transparent rules, for example in the areas of recruitment, appraisal and working conditions,
  • better support for professional development, including onboarding, mentoring and training,
  • a stronger focus on ethics, integrity and a safe and respectful working environment,
  • greater credibility for VŠPJ amongst national and international partners, as it is a mark of quality recognised throughout Europe.

A collaborative process with an impact on day-to-day practice

It is important to emphasise that this is not merely an administrative process. Staff across the university will be involved in the preparation, both through data collection and by discussing which areas should be prioritised for development in the action plan. The aim is to establish measures that will meet the real needs of VŠPJ, be applicable in day-to-day practice and contribute to improving the quality of the creative and research environment in the long term.
